Each applicant must also certify that
the products and services it seeks to
export through the mission are either
produced in the United States, or, if not,
marketed under the name of a U.S. firm
and have at least 51 percent U.S.
content of the value of the finished
product or service. In the case of a trade
association, the applicant must certify
that for each company to be represented
by the association, the products and/or
services the represented company seeks
to export are either produced in the
United States or, if not, marketed under
the name of a U.S. firm and have at least
fifty-one percent U.S. content.

Criteria for Participation
Selection will be based on the
following criteria:
• Suitability of the company’s (or in
the case of a trade association, member
companies’) products or services to the
market.
• Applicant’s (or in the case of a trade
association, member companies’)
potential for business in Russia and in
the region, including likelihood of
exports resulting from the mission.
• Consistency of the applicant’s (or in
the case of a trade association, member
companies’) goals and objectives with
the stated scope of the mission.
Diversity of company size, sector or
subsector, and location may also be
considered during the review process.
Referrals from political organizations
and any documents containing
references to partisan political activities
(including political contributions) will
be removed from an applicant’s
submission and not considered during
the selection process.

DEPARTMENT OF COMMERCE
International Trade Administration
U.S. Infrastructure Trade Mission to Colombia and Panama; Bogota,
Columbia and Panama City, Panama, May 13-16, 2012; Correction
AGENCY: International Trade Administration, Department of Commerce.
ACTION: Notice; Correction.
-----------------------------------------------------------------------
SUMMARY: The United States Department of Commerce, International Trade
Administration, U.S. and Foreign Commercial Service published a
document in the Federal Register of December 4, 2012 regarding the U.S.
Infrastructure Trade Mission to Colombia and Panama May 13-16, 2013.
The subject heading of the document incorrectly indicated the year 2012
instead of 2013. All other information in the December 4, 2012 Notice,
including the February 15, 2013 application deadline, is correct.

Correction
In the Federal Register of December 4, 2012, in FR Doc. 2012-29306
on page 71778, first column, correct the subject heading of the notice
to read: U.S. Infrastructure Trade Mission to Colombia and Panama;
Bogota, Columbia and Panama City, Panama, May 13-16, 2013.
